What eats razor clams?

* Marine birds: Seagulls, oystercatchers, and other marine birds eat razor clams by digging into the sand to find them.

* Fish: Some species of fish, such as flounder and halibut, eat razor clams. They typically locate them by smell and then swallow them whole.

* Marine mammals: Seals, sea lions, and other marine mammals occasionally eat razor clams as a food source.

* Human beings: Razor clams are a popular seafood dish and are often harvested commercially and also for recreational purposes.
